WebJan 11, 2024 · Healthy plants absorb blue and red light to drive photosynthesis and make chlorophyll. Chlorophyll reflects near-infrared radiation. Since a healthy plant has more chlorophyll than an unhealthy plant, one can monitor the health of the plant by measuring the amount of reflected near-IR light. WebWhile interaction with infrared light causes molecules to undergo vibrational transitions, the shorter wavelength, higher energy radiation in the UV (200-400 nm) and visible (400-700 nm) range of the electromagnetic spectrum causes many organic molecules to undergo electronic transitions.
